
jQuery – DOM 조작 – 0 – 요소의 선택과 조작
소제목: jQuery를 사용하여 DOM 요소 선택하기
jQuery는 DOM(Document Object Model) 요소를 선택하고 조작하는 데 도움이 되는 강력한 라이브러리입니다. jQuery를 사용하면 간편한 선택자를 통해 요소를 선택하고, 이를 통해 원하는 조작을 수행할 수 있습니다.
예시:
// ID를 사용하여 요소 선택하기
$("#myElement")
// 클래스를 사용하여 요소 선택하기
$(".myClass")
// 태그 이름을 사용하여 요소 선택하기
$("div")
// 속성을 사용하여 요소 선택하기
$("[name='myName']")
이렇게 jQuery를 사용하면 CSS 선택자와 유사한 형식으로 DOM 요소를 선택할 수 있습니다. 선택한 요소에는 다양한 조작을 적용할 수 있습니다.
소제목: DOM 요소 조작하기
jQuery를 사용하여 선택한 DOM 요소를 조작하는 것은 매우 간단합니다. 선택한 요소에는 CSS 스타일 변경, 속성 설정, 내용 변경 등 다양한 조작을 적용할 수 있습니다.
예시:
// CSS 스타일 변경
$("#myElement").css("color", "red");
// 속성 설정
$("#myElement").attr("src", "image.jpg");
// 내용 변경
$("#myElement").text("새로운 내용");
// 요소 추가
$("#myElement").append("<p>추가된 요소</p>");
// 요소 제거
$("#myElement").remove();
이렇게 jQuery를 사용하면 선택한 요소의 스타일, 속성, 내용을 변경하거나 새로운 요소를 추가하거나 제거할 수 있습니다. 이는 마치 마술사가 요소를 조작하는 것과 같은 느낌입니다.
소제목: 요소의 선택과 조작을 한데 묶어서 이해하기
jQuery는 마치 DOM 요소를 선택하는 마법사와 같습니다. 선택자를 사용하여 원하는 요소를 선택하고, 선택한 요소에 원하는 조작을 적용합니다. 이를 통해 웹 페이지를 동적이고 상호작용적으로 만들 수 있습니다.
예를 들어, 웹 페이지에 있는 모든 제목 태그를 선택하고, 이를 빨간색으로 변경하고, 글자 크기를 키우고 싶다고 가정해보겠습니다. 이를 jQuery를 사용하여 간단하게 구현할 수 있습니다.
// 제목 태그 선택 및 조작
$("h1, h2, h3").css({
"color": "red",
"font-size": "24px"
});
위의 코드는 “h1”, “h2”, “h3” 태그를 선택하고, 이를 빨간색으로 변경하고 글자 크기를 24px로 설정합니다. 이러한 요소의 선택과 조작은 jQuery의 강력한 기능 중 하나입니다.
소제목: 주의해야 할 점
jQuery를 사용하여 DOM 요소를 선택하고 조작하는 것은 편리하고 강력한 기능입니다. 그러나 몇 가지 주의해야 할 점이 있습니다.
-
jQuery의 최신 버전을 사용하십시오: jQuery는 지속적으로 업데이트되고 개선되고 있습니다. 따라서 최신 버전을 사용하여 보안 및 성능 문제를 피하는 것이 좋습니다.
-
필요한 경우에만 사용하십시오: jQuery는 훌륭한 라이브러리이지만, 모든 상황에서 사용할 필요는 없습니다. 일부 간단한 작업에는 순수한 JavaScript로도 충분할 수 있습니다.
-
DOM 요소 선택의 과용을 피하십시오: jQuery는 강력한 선택자를 제공하지만, 지나치게 많은 DOM 요소를 선택하면 성능 저하가 발생할 수 있습니다. 필요한 요소만 선택하고 최적화된 선택자를 사용하십시오.
-
네이티브 JavaScript에 익숙해지십시오: jQuery를 사용하기 전에 JavaScript의 기본 개념과 문법에 익숙해지는 것이 좋습니다. 이는 jQuery를 더 효과적으로 활용하고, 문제가 발생했을 때 해결할 수 있는 능력을 키울 수 있습니다.
-
CDN을 사용할 때 주의하십시오: jQuery를 사용할 때 외부 CDN(Content Delivery Network)을 이용하는 경우, CDN 서버에 장애가 발생하면 jQuery를 가져올 수 없어 웹 페이지가 제대로 작동하지 않을 수 있습니다. 이 경우 로컬에 jQuery를 다운로드하거나 대체 CDN을 사용하는 것을 고려해야 합니다.
이러한 주의사항을 유념하면서 jQuery를 사용하면 DOM 요소의 선택과 조작을 쉽게 수행할 수 있습니다. 활용 방법을 익히고 실전에서 적용해보면 더욱 능숙해질 것입니다.
위와 같이, jQuery를 사용하여 DOM 요소의 선택과 조작에 대해 소제목과 예시를 포함하여 쉽게 이해할 수 있도록 설명해드렸습니다. jQuery는 웹 개발에서 널리 사용되는 도구 중 하나이며, 유용하고 강력한 기능을 제공합니다. 즐겁게 jQuery를 활용하여 웹 페이지를 만들어보세요!